DAX (data analysis expressions) - Email Marketing

What is DAX?

Data Analysis Expressions (DAX) is a collection of functions, operators, and constants that can be used in formulas or expressions to calculate and return one or more values. Originating from Microsoft's Power BI, Power Pivot, and Analysis Services, DAX is essential for building powerful data models and performing sophisticated data analysis.

How Can DAX Benefit Email Marketing?

Email marketing involves analyzing a vast amount of data such as open rates, click-through rates, conversion rates, and subscriber engagement. Utilizing DAX can help marketers to create more insightful reports and dashboards that drive data-driven decisions. With DAX, you can segment your audience, analyze the performance of different campaigns, and optimize your email marketing strategy.

Key DAX Functions for Email Marketing

Several DAX functions can be particularly beneficial in the context of email marketing:
CALCULATE: Enables you to perform calculations in a modified filter context. Useful for comparing different segments of your email list.
SUM and SUMX: Allow you to sum values. You can use these to calculate total clicks, opens, or conversions.
FILTER: Helps in narrowing down data sets based on specific criteria. Ideal for segmenting your audience based on engagement levels.
AVERAGE and AVERAGEX: Calculate averages, which can be helpful for understanding average open rates or click-through rates.
RELATED: Fetches related data in a different table. This can be useful for linking subscriber demographics with their engagement data.

How to Implement DAX in Email Marketing Analysis?

To implement DAX effectively in email marketing analysis, follow these steps:
Data Collection: First, gather all relevant email marketing data. This includes information on sends, opens, clicks, bounces, and conversions.
Data Modeling: Organize your data into tables. For example, you could have tables for subscribers, campaigns, and interactions.
Creating Measures: Use DAX to create measures that calculate key metrics like open rates, click-through rates, and conversion rates. For instance, you can use the CALCULATE function to measure the open rate of a specific campaign.
Segmentation: Use the FILTER function to segment your audience based on various criteria like location, age, or past behavior.
Reporting: Finally, create visualizations and reports in Power BI to present your findings. Use DAX measures to create dynamic and interactive dashboards.

Common Challenges and Solutions

While DAX is powerful, it comes with its own set of challenges:
Complexity: DAX has a steep learning curve. To overcome this, start with basic functions and gradually move to more complex calculations.
Performance: Large data sets can slow down calculations. Optimize your data model and use efficient DAX formulas to improve performance.
Context: Understanding row context and filter context is crucial. Misunderstanding these can lead to incorrect results. Practice and continuous learning can help you master these concepts.

Conclusion

Incorporating DAX into your email marketing analytics can significantly enhance your ability to make data-driven decisions. By understanding and utilizing key DAX functions, you can develop more sophisticated and insightful analyses, leading to better campaign performance and higher subscriber engagement. While there are challenges, the benefits far outweigh the difficulties, making DAX an invaluable tool for any email marketer.

Cities We Serve